Ticket: Partner SFTP drop failing since last night. Heads up, support folks — the nightly feed from Quillmark Logistics into our Harborline drop is bouncing because the upload credentials expired over the weekend. Their files are piling up and their ops lead is understandably antsy. I've re-provisioned access on our side via the Harborline admin service. To re-enable the sync job, plug the fresh credential into the relay config. The new key for the relay service is below.

app token of hahaf-bafop = qvz3-arh

**Q: Why does the Fernwick read-replica lag alarm fire during nightly compaction?**

Compaction on the primary briefly delays replication, so lag spikes past the 30-second threshold are expected between 02:00 and 03:00. Only sustained lag outside that window needs investigation. Tuning history and the decision record for the threshold are kept on the page below.

operations page: https://jenkins.zemvarcloud.local/job/merge_requests/repo/build/73930b4b30f0a8ed

## Tuning

The bloom filter sits in front of the Korval key-value store and short-circuits reads for keys that definitely don't exist. This saves a disk seek per miss, which matters because our workload is roughly 60% misses. Sizing is a tradeoff: a bigger filter lowers false positives but eats RAM on every node. Rebuilds happen on compaction, so resizing only takes effect after the next cycle. Don't tune false-positive rate below 0.1% without measuring memory first. Current production values are defined here.

tuning table, yajog-yahof:
BUDGETS = {
    "lamvan": 303,
    "wenox": 460,
    "fenvan": 525,
}

## Guest Wi-Fi Desk — Night Shift Notes

The guest Wi-Fi desk at Corvane Tower reception stays unstaffed after 21:00. If an overnight visitor needs network access, night-shift staff should issue a printed voucher from the drawer beneath the desk. The drawer is kept locked; open it using the code provided below.

turnstile pass: bdg-NG-3